IELTS Writing Task 2 Checker (Free): How to Use It the Right Way

Most students only look at the score. High scorers look at why they lost points in Task Response, Coherence, Vocabulary, and Grammar.

What a good Task 2 checker should give you

  • 1. A criterion-level diagnosis, not only a total band.
  • 2. Sentence-level examples of weak logic and unclear argument links.
  • 3. A concrete rewrite plan for your next draft.

3-step workflow to improve faster

Step 1: Diagnose. Submit one Task 2 essay and identify your lowest criterion.

Step 2: Rewrite. Fix only the top 2 issues (for example, topic sentence clarity and example depth).

Step 3: Re-check. Compare before/after to confirm measurable improvement.

Common mistake

Students switch topics every day. Better approach: keep one topic, iterate 2-3 drafts, and raise one criterion at a time. If you are stuck at 6.5, this is usually the fastest path to 7.
